Output d2603e55b1d42f1f59fa0fcc9a79a52e4bf8c5645e2e5a7e2dde2143754c8c19:1

value
688150
script pubkey
OP_0 OP_PUSHBYTES_20 525808b467471bee72fdd90a29e5b7c08a371159
address
bc1q2fvq3dr8gud7uuhamy9znedhcz9rwy2elpfh55
transaction
d2603e55b1d42f1f59fa0fcc9a79a52e4bf8c5645e2e5a7e2dde2143754c8c19
confirmations
142841
spent
true